Spec's Wines, Spirits & Finer Foods
10505 W Fairmont Pkwy, La Porte TX 77571
(832) 568-1891
Directions
Order Online Delivery
Instacart
Doordash
Specsonline
La Porte, Texas
Spec's Wines, Spirits & Finer Foods
10505 W Fairmont Pkwy, La Porte
(832) 568-1891